新一代AI模型免费开放:开发者如何高效利用低延迟特性

对于开发者而言,文献综述、代码注释生成、技术文档撰写等任务往往需要耗费大量时间,尤其是在面对海量数据或紧急项目周期时,传统工具的延迟和成本问题愈发凸显。新一代AI模型通过免费开放和超低延迟特性,为开发者提供了更高效的解决方案。本文将从技术架构、核心优势、应用场景及实践技巧四个维度展开分析,帮助开发者快速掌握这一工具的使用方法。

一、技术架构:轻量化与高性能的平衡

新一代AI模型采用混合专家架构(Mixture of Experts, MoE),通过动态路由机制将输入分配至不同的专家子网络,实现计算资源的高效利用。相较于传统大模型,其核心优化点包括:

  1. 动态计算分配:根据输入复杂度自动调整激活的专家数量,避免全量计算带来的资源浪费。例如,简单查询可能仅触发1-2个专家,而复杂任务则调用更多专家协同处理。
  2. 量化压缩技术:通过4-bit或8-bit量化将模型参数压缩至原始大小的1/4至1/8,显著降低内存占用和推理延迟。实测数据显示,量化后的模型在保持95%以上精度的同时,推理速度提升3倍。
  3. 分布式推理引擎:支持多节点并行推理,通过负载均衡和任务分片技术,将长文本处理任务拆解为多个子任务并行执行。例如,处理10万字文档时,可将其分割为100个1000字片段,由不同节点同时处理。

二、核心优势:免费与低延迟的双重价值

  1. 零成本接入
    开发者无需支付模型使用费用或API调用费用,可直接通过公开接口或本地部署使用。这一特性对预算有限的初创团队或个人开发者尤为友好。例如,某开源社区项目通过集成该模型,将文档生成成本从每月数千元降至零。

  2. 毫秒级响应
    在标准服务器环境下(如8核CPU+32GB内存),模型对短文本(<500字)的响应时间可控制在200ms以内,长文本(<10万字)的首字延迟低于1秒。这一性能指标接近实时交互需求,适用于在线客服、实时翻译等场景。

  3. 多模态支持
    除文本生成外,模型还支持代码生成、表格解析、简单图像描述等多模态任务。例如,开发者可通过自然语言描述生成SQL查询语句,或将Markdown表格转换为JSON格式。

三、典型应用场景与代码实践

  1. 文献综述自动化
    场景:快速提炼多篇论文的核心观点,生成结构化综述。
    实践

    1. # 示例:调用模型API生成文献综述
    2. import requests
    3. def generate_literature_review(papers):
    4. api_url = "https://api.example.com/generate"
    5. headers = {"Authorization": "Bearer YOUR_API_KEY"}
    6. payload = {
    7. "task": "literature_review",
    8. "papers": papers, # 输入论文列表,每篇包含标题、摘要、关键词
    9. "max_length": 1000
    10. }
    11. response = requests.post(api_url, headers=headers, json=payload)
    12. return response.json()["output"]
    13. papers = [
    14. {"title": "Paper A", "abstract": "...", "keywords": ["AI", "NLP"]},
    15. {"title": "Paper B", "abstract": "...", "keywords": ["ML", "Deep Learning"]}
    16. ]
    17. print(generate_literature_review(papers))

    效果:输入10篇论文后,模型可在30秒内生成包含“研究背景”“方法对比”“结论总结”等章节的综述文档。

  2. 代码注释生成
    场景:为遗留代码或复杂函数自动添加注释,提升可维护性。
    实践

    1. # 示例:生成Python函数注释
    2. def auto_comment_code(code_snippet):
    3. api_url = "https://api.example.com/generate"
    4. headers = {"Authorization": "Bearer YOUR_API_KEY"}
    5. payload = {
    6. "task": "code_comment",
    7. "code": code_snippet,
    8. "language": "python"
    9. }
    10. response = requests.post(api_url, headers=headers, json=payload)
    11. return response.json()["output"]
    12. code = """
    13. def train_model(X, y, epochs=10):
    14. model = Sequential()
    15. model.add(Dense(64, activation='relu'))
    16. model.add(Dense(1, activation='sigmoid'))
    17. model.compile(loss='binary_crossentropy', optimizer='adam')
    18. model.fit(X, y, epochs=epochs)
    19. return model
    20. """
    21. print(auto_comment_code(code))

    效果:模型可生成包含参数说明、返回值描述和算法逻辑的详细注释,例如:

    1. # 训练二分类模型
    2. # 参数:
    3. # X: 输入特征矩阵,形状为(n_samples, n_features)
    4. # y: 标签向量,形状为(n_samples,)
    5. # epochs: 训练轮数,默认为10
    6. # 返回值:
    7. # 训练好的Keras模型对象

四、性能优化与注意事项

  1. 批量处理策略
    对于批量任务(如处理100篇文献),建议采用异步调用+轮询机制,避免同步等待导致的超时问题。例如,通过分批次提交任务(每批20篇),并在后台轮询任务状态。

  2. 输入长度控制
    模型对输入长度有限制(通常为32K tokens),超长文本需先分割为片段再处理。可使用滑动窗口算法实现无缝拼接:

    1. def split_text(text, max_length=32000, overlap=1000):
    2. segments = []
    3. start = 0
    4. while start < len(text):
    5. end = min(start + max_length, len(text))
    6. segments.append(text[start:end])
    7. start += max_length - overlap
    8. return segments
  3. 结果校验机制
    尽管模型精度较高,但仍需对关键输出(如代码、数学公式)进行人工校验。例如,生成的SQL查询需通过单元测试验证逻辑正确性。

新一代AI模型通过免费开放和超低延迟特性,为开发者提供了高效处理文本、代码和多模态数据的工具。其混合专家架构、量化压缩技术和分布式推理引擎,确保了在资源受限环境下的高性能表现。开发者可通过文献综述自动化、代码注释生成等场景快速落地应用,同时需注意批量处理、输入分割和结果校验等优化技巧。随着技术迭代,此类模型有望进一步降低开发门槛,推动AI普惠化进程。